The Messenger of Allaah (sallAllaahu `alayhi wa sallam) said,
“Whoever fails to care for our youth, respect our aged, enjoin right, and denounce wrong is not counted among us.” [Imaam Ahmad]

The Messenger of Allaah (sallAllaahu `alayhi wa sallam) said,
“Speak the truth even though it be bitter.” [Ibn Hibbaan]
